If your LFS is 'a bit pricey' but the quality is up to your expectations, I'd always go with the LFS! You can see the fish first, and you support a local business- one you might need when the sh#t hits the fan..

I only buy my fish from one specific shop; I know their way and I know how the fish are handled.
To me, supporting a local shop is extremely important. I like to build relationships with businesses. This way if you are in need of help rather quickly or need some extra advice or you are in a tough situation, they are more willing to help. Plus, if your LFS sells quality livestock you know what you are getting and will have less problems.
